Started repainting my YM2000, I will post photos as I go. The fenders and the hood had alot of surface rust spots, ground and sandblasted all the spots, filled and primed. Using TSC implement paint MF red, white, and black for the frame and chassis, First pic is before, second in process

Started repainting my YM2000, I will post photos as I go. The fenders and the hood had alot of surface rust spots, ground and sandblasted all the spots, filled and primed. Using TSC implement paint MF red, white, and black for the frame and chassis, First pic is before, second in process

Unless you plan on stripping, cleaning, priming, painting each and every piece on the chassis, engine, and frame, I would forget about changing to black and just touch up the green, otherwise you could end up with a big mess.
 
/ Repaint YM2000 #11  
I agree with Normde...the green will always want to show through especially around the grease. I tried this an implement and it looked great for about 6 mo then it was a mess ...I then had to do it right.

California can you confirm.
I don't know the answer to that one.

My (US) YM240, equivalent to YM2000, has the optional HD, adjustable width front axle same as shown in the back of its parts manual under 'options'. (And I assume this is simply the axle off a larger model). I think the tractor was ordered loader-ready, and the loader may have been put on before it was ever sold.

Mine has the four cover bolts as shown in Carey's photo. I read somewhere, and have always assumed, that this is a sealed bearing. Seems to me it would have to be, the way these tractors are run half submerged in the rice paddies.
